In the Salon interview, Gartner explained that Trump shows signs of degenerating mentally by exhibiting phonemic paraphasias during his rally speeches. The psychiatrist pointed out this is “the substitution of non-words for words that sound similar—are not normally seen until a patient enters the moderate to severe stages of Alzheimer’s.”

And he demonstrated some symptoms of this condition.

“Some examples of Trump’s non-words: Beneficiaries becomes ‘benefishes.’ Renovations become ‘renoversh.’ Pivotal became ‘pivobal.’ Obama became ‘Obamna.’ Missiles became ‘mishiz.’ Christmas became ‘Crissus.’ Bipartisan became ‘bipars.’ This is a fundamental breakdown in the ability to use language. If you were talking to your father on the phone and he did this you would think he is having a stroke. There is no healthy older person who speaks that way.”

Gartner also referred to Trump’s habit of going off-topic when addressing crowds.

“Trump also engages in what we call ‘tangential speech.’ He becomes incomprehensible when he engages in free association word salad speech that is all over the place. Again, that’s a sign of real brain damage, not being old, not being slow, not losing a step not being, but of severe cognitive deterioration,” he explained.

While Biden is being criticized for forgetting names, which isn’t unusual for elderly people, Gartner explained that Trump is “forgetting and combining people,” not just mispronouncing names.
